Nido is a communal earth installation created during the 2021 Fare Nido artist residency at Ecomuseo Mare Memoria Viva in Palermo. Co-created with the transcultural art collective Idea Destroying Muros and Vide Terra, the project brought together artistic practice, natural building techniques and collective making.

The 2.5-metre earth dome was conceived as a place of gathering, shelter and return – a space for pausing, listening, sharing stories and being together. Its nest-like form evokes care, protection and the circular movement of leaving and coming back.

The structure was built collectively using the Superadobe technique and finished with traditional cocciopesto plaster made from natural materials. The construction process became part of the artwork itself: knowledge was shared through hands-on making, bringing together artists, researchers, local participants and the museum community.

Rather than treating earth simply as a building material, Nido approaches it as a medium for creating relationships – between people, place, material and memory.
